Heart of Midlothian FC (Wom) defeated Celtic LFC (Wom) 4-1, signaling a dominant home performance. Hearts struck twice inside the opening six minutes, with the first at 00:40:24 and the second at 00:45:06 to establish a 2-0 lead. The third followed at 00:47:21, pushing the advantage to 3-0 before Celtic’s reply at 00:57:09; Hearts sealed the win with a fourth at 01:09:27. Celtic also received a red card, a decisive turning point that reshaped the balance of play.
Attacking intent was clearest in Hearts’ early front-foot pressure, turning two rapid goals inside the opening half into a dominant lead. The visitors attempted more forward runs, evidenced by Celtic earning three offsides to Hearts’ one, indicating higher retrieval pressure and willingness to play in behind. Hearts also led on set-piece opportunities with four corners to Celtic’s two, creating repeated crossable moments in the box.
Defensively, Hearts conceded only one goal and maintained a relatively clean discipline profile aside from the extra attention paid to Celtic’s attacks. The foul count was close (Hearts 10, Celtic 11), suggesting a tightly contested middle phase with limited clear-cut chances for Celtic after going behind. Yellow cards were modest (Hearts 2, Celtic 1), reinforcing the view of a controlled pressing display from the home side.
Set-piece advantage played a measurable role, with Hearts generating more corners and hence more moments to test Celtic’s box entries. The red card for Celtic disrupted their rhythm and likely reduced their capacity to convert pressure into sustained midfield or defensive solidity. Without data on shot quality or saves, the impact appears most pronounced through numerical advantage and increased dead-ball opportunities for Hearts.
Teamwork and tactical insight point to Hearts’ cohesive structure, with quick transitions and a compact approach that kept Celtic under sustained pressure after the opening blows. Celtic showed brief attacking sparks before the dismissal, but the numerical disadvantage severely limited their defensive and offensive balance. The result highlights how a disciplined, coherent home setup can exploit an opponent’s discipline lapse to build and protect a commanding lead.
